Speitel, Thomas W. – Science Teacher, 1991
Explains how a computer uses its vision to determine the area, edge length, width, height, and center of mass in two dimensions from photos of backlit sea shells. Includes HyperCard codes used to instruct the computer to make the calculations. (MDH)
